The Dynamic Tension of Hoisting Steel Wire Rope

Abstract

In the current state standard Crane Design Rules,the effective steel wire rope's tension is calculated at the rope's maximum static working tension. However,in some working cases of the crane,such as the case of lifting when leaving ground suddenly or of braking when falling,an additional dynamic tension in the rope will be appeared. Based on the vibration theory of single degree of freedom system,this paper discusses the dynamic tension in the rope in those cases.The results are more accurate to the actual data than those from safe coefficient method to determine the rope strength by the mechanism specifications group.
